In the attached mathml example, test.html, the integral symbol has small cuts in it and the underbrace does not show up. I've attached a screenshot comparing WebKit trunk @r133913 and Firefox.

It seems that you don't have the STIX fonts installed on your system. Webkit should probably do as Firefox and use the size variant for the integral and ignore the construction with several parts. This depends on bug 99614 and bug 72828.
